Vancouver Whitecaps FC mourn the loss of former assistant coach John Buchanan

Vancouver Whitecaps FC are mourning the passing of John Buchanan, a beloved member of the club and the Canada Soccer family.

Buchanan was the club's assistant coach during their inaugural 1974-75 NASL season.

An honoured member of the Soccer Hall of Fame, Buchanan was a former coach and general manager with Canada Soccer in the late 1970's and early 1980's.

Buchanan was also a long-time soccer and golf coach at Simon Fraser University and was a charter member of the SFU Athletics Hall of Fame in 1986, working for the university for 50 years. He established the school's soccer program and coached the school to the 1976 NAIA national title, also winning seven consecutive regional championships before he retired in 1981.
